My first experience of dog sledding was during the winter of 2001, it was one of the best adventurous things I have done. On my first occasion the weather was cold and sunny. Today it was blowing a blizzard, so eat your heart out Jack London! The dogs were soon roped up, reindeer skins put on the sled along with the anchor. When ever you stop the anchor must be put down or you could be left behind in the wilderness as the dogs carry on without you. After checking all was in order, to the shout of "mush mush" it was off across the virgin white snow. With all the rivers streams and lakes frozen we had no obstructions and were able to go anywhere. It was great fun to sled along forest tracks with the wind howling through the trees. As darkness enveloped us we made our way back to the kennels, it was time to feed the dogs then bed them down for the night.

Martin James, England
